It has been a very busy run for Bruce Springsteen. Last year, he released the strong latter-day E Street album Letter To You, itself a quick followup to 2019’s solo outing Western Stars. Both of those arrived as plot twists at the same time that superfans have chased rumors about the long-awaited Born In The U.S.A. archival reissue, and the even more long-awaited Tracks successor potentially featuring lost albums. Just a month ago, Springsteen was also talking about another new album on the horizon. After holding off on releasing music for a good chunk of the ’10s, it seemed he was making up for lost time.

Bruce Springsteen: Watch Bruce Springsteen And The E Street Band Play “If I Was The Priest” For The First Time In 51 Years
submitted by Nick Feb 15th 2023 07:00 pm (www.stereogum.com)
Bruce Springsteen estimates he wrote “If I Was The Priest” in 1970 or 1971, and he sometimes played it with the E Street Band at shows up until 1972. After that, the Boss sidelined the song for almost five decades until recording it for 2020’s Letter To You. And now, finally, it has returned to their setlist after 5...
